Football Sweeps NACC Weekly Honors

MEQUON, Wis. - The Northern Athletics Collegiate Conference announced its Student-Athletes of the Week awards for Football on Wednesday morning. Coming off a 37-21 victory over Eureka, the Falcons swept this week's honors with junior James Linn, senior Dwayne Rackard III and sophomore Mason Kaschinski.

A junior quarterback from Chino Hills, California, James Linn is claiming the NACC Offensive Player of the Week honor for the first time in his career. Linn passed for 386 yards against Eureka and finished the game with five touchdowns in the victory.

A senior linebacker from Orlando, Florida, Dwayne Rackard III is taking the NACC Defensive Player of the Week title for the first time this season and the second time in his career. Rackard tore up the Red Devil's offense on Saturday and finished the game with 13 total tackles and recovered one fumble. He also broke up two passes.

A sophomore from Fort Wayne, Indiana, Mason Kaschinske is being honored as the NACC Special Teams Player of the Week for the first time in his career. On Saturday, he added four extra points and landed his lone field goal attempt on the afternoon. He also punted once against Eureka and pinned the Red Devils inside the 20-yard line.

The Falcons finished the season with a winning record at 3-2 on the year.
